AceShowbiz - On Friday the 13th, Jamie Foxx's birthday dinner at the renowned Mr. Chow restaurant in Beverly Hills took a shocking twist. The "Collateral" actor was hit in the face by a glass during an altercation, resulting in him needing stitches.
A spokesperson for Foxx told USA TODAY, "Jamie Foxx was at his birthday dinner when someone from another table threw a glass that hit him in the mouth. He had to get stitches and is recovering."
The incident, initially reported as an assault with a deadly weapon, prompted a call to the Beverly Hills Police Department (BHPD). According to a press release obtained by Page Six, law enforcement responded to Mr. Chow at 10:06 p.m. They confirmed the incident "involved a physical altercation between parties," but no arrests were made. The BHPD continues its investigation into the matter.
This surprising event came shortly after Foxx's recent health scare. In April 2023, while working on the Netflix film "Back in Action," he was hospitalized for a "medical complication."
The details remain private, but the actor spent weeks in recovery, eventually moving to a rehabilitation center. Celebrities and fans shared overwhelming support during his recovery, with Foxx later posting on Instagram to thank everyone for their prayers and to dismiss rumors of severe issues.
Despite these challenges, Foxx has remained resilient. He recently took to the stage for his new Netflix comedy special, "Jamie Foxx: What Had Happened Was," where he candidly discussed his health battle and expressed gratitude to fans.
"If I can stay funny, I can stay alive," Foxx quipped during the special. This marks his first major solo release in 2024, following his involvement in other projects, such as co-producing the Luther Vandross documentary, "Luther: Never Too Much."
Foxx's birthday celebration at Mr. Chow's, attended by his daughters Corinne and Anelise and his ex Kristin Grannis, was meant to be a night of joy and reflection. Speaking outside the restaurant prior to the incident, Foxx shared his gratitude for another birthday following his near-death health scare. "It's beautiful because I didn't know if I would be here to celebrate it," he told photographers.
